In Need Of Some Wine Tips? Start Here!

June 28, 2020 by George

Wine is perfect as a luxurious escape and way to celebrate life since the beginning of time. This article will guide you to great starting resource.

Pinot Grigio is a great choice for a wine served with your seafood dinner. The wine can really help to bring out the flavor of the food. White wine in general is also a good choice to pair with seafood. This is a great way to make for an amazing meal.

If you drink wine with your meal and you get frequent headaches, you may want to limit how often you partake in wine. Drinking in moderation will probably be your best thing that you can do.

Learn about the place where you buy your wine. Every store is different. Selections and prices can vary, depending on the store you are in. If you are still a novice, do not go to a store where you will only have expensive bottles to choose from. Try to choose a shop that fits your needs.

Do not let the sulfite warnings on the wine labels. All wines contain sulfites, but it’s the American made versions that must show a warning.While sulfites have been known to cause certain allergic reactions in rare cases, there is no need to worry if this has not been a problem in the past.

Wine tastings are great to attend. These fun gatherings will help you to discover new and exciting wines. This can even be a fun social event for you and your family and friends. If you know anyone else who is curious about wine or loves it, invite them as well. You may develop a better relationship with those you love while also enjoying something that you love.

If you are going to buy wine for tailgating, consider purchasing a bottle that has a screw top. You won’t have to trouble yourself with you. They also provide a more secure seal than traditional corks do.

Buy a few different bottles of wine if you want to sample several flavors. Your tastes may not lie along traditional lines, and you do not want to spend all that money just for appearances. Don’t break the bank on an entire case unless you’re sure you like it.

Not every white wines should be chilled before serving. White wines have different textures, and therefore may benefit from a variety of temperatures. Sauvignon blanc is at its best when chilled, while a chardonnay or pinot gris can stand to be a little warmer.

A dessert wine makes a perfect for drinking after dinner drink. Some examples of great dessert wines include French Champagne, Italian Moscato, or even California Port.Your guests will love your selection of wine can bring.

It is best to drink white wines while they are within their first two years. The exception would be Chardonnay. The main reason to do this is for the reason that oak doesn’t generally get used when making a white wine. This may not apply for dark wines or other varieties.

Only buy wines that you enjoy. Some restaurants and bars promote a certain brand. These are usually priced up to 20 times the wholesale price. More costly wine doesn’t always mean an increase in quality. Know what kinds of wines you prefer and stick with those.

There are different Spanish wines and each has its own storage requirements, but it is generally a wine that is easy to keep fresh. Most people drink Rioja in our country, and it will last as long as seven years after being bottled. Store the bottle in a cook, dark place until you are ready to enjoy it.

Toasts are quite common at social groupings. This can result in the distinctive sound of clinking glasses. If not done correctly, it may shatter, creating a large mess.

Wine is good for cooking and for drinking by itself. You could, for instance, have a nice steak dinner cooked with some red wine. White wine may be used to cook seafood dishes like scallops and fish. Pouring in a touch of wine when cooking can boost your meal’s flavor.
